Yuxarı-Aşağı (İrəli-geri) sayıcıda olan CU,CD,RESET,LOAD VƏ PV parametrləri sayıcının girişləri,QU,QD, CƏ CV parametrləri isə sayıcının çıxışlarıdır.Yuxarı-Aşağı sayıcıda CU və CD girişləri Yüksələn kənar (Pozitiv kənar) qavrayış özəlliyinə sahibdir.CU,CD,RESET,LOAD,QU VƏ QD,BOOL tipində,PV(Preset Value:Sayıcı ayar dəyəri) və CV(Counter Value:Sayıcı ani dəyəri) isə İNT tipində parametrlərdir.
(Sayıcı dəyişkəni CTUD tanımlanmalıdır.)
(Sayıcı dəyişkəni CTUD tanımlanmalıdır.)
CAL Sayıcı(CU6S0,CD:=S1,RESET:S2, LOAD:S3,PV:=5)
LD Sayıcı.Q
ST Q0
Sayıcı(CU:S0,CD:=S1,RESET:S2,LOAD:=S3,PV:=5);
Q0:Sayıcı.Q;
1.İrəli-Geri sayıcıda RESET girişi gəldiyi zaman (S2=RESET=TRUE) sayıcı ani dəyəri sıfırlanır.(CV=0).
1.İrəli-Geri sayıcıda RESET girişi gəldiyi zaman (S2=RESET=TRUE) sayıcı ani dəyəri sıfırlanır.(CV=0).
2.İrəli-Geri sayıcıda LOAD girişi gəldiyi zaman (S3=RESET=TRUE) SAYICI ANİ DƏYƏRİNƏ(qiymətinə) (CV),sayıcı ayar dəyəri (PV) yüklənir.(CV=PV).
3.İrəli-Geri sayıcıda hər CU girişi gəldiyində (S0=CU=TRUE) sayıcı ani dəyəri(qiyməti) (CV) 1 (bir) artar.
4.İrəli-Geri sayıcıda hər CD girişi gəldiyində (S1=CD=TRUE) sayıcı ani dəyəri (qiyməti) (CV) 1 (bir) azalır.
5.Sayıcı ani qiyməti (CV),sıfıra bərabər olduğu zaman sayıcı QD çıxışı,çıxış verir (QD=TRUE).Sayıcı ani qiyməti (CV),sıfırdan fərqli olduğu zaman sayıcı QD çıxışı,çıxış verməz (QD=FALSE).
6.Sayıcı ani qiyməti (CV),sayıcı ayar dəyərinə(qiymətinə) (PV) bərabər olduğu yada PV qiymətindən böyük olduğu zaman sayıcı QU çıxışı,çıxış verir (QU=TRUE).Sayıcı ani qiyməti (CV) sayıcı ani qiymətindən (PV),kiçik olduğu zaman sayıcı QU çıxışı,çıxış verməz.(QU=FALSE).